7 way to remove rust pipe fitting

In CNC machining and precision metal fabrication, surface rust on steel parts is a common challenge, especially for products that require a natural, anti-rust oil finish without additional plating. Unlike electroplated or coated components, these parts cannot rely on protective metal layers, making rust removal a critical and often difficult step in the manufacturing process. Proper rust prevention and careful handling are essential to maintain both the functionality and the aesthetic of the final product.

In metalworking and CNC machining, rust removal can generally be divided into two main approaches: physical removal and chemical (solution-based) removal.

  1. Physical Rust Removal for pipe fititng 

    • Methods like wire brushing, sandpaper,Scouring pad,Wire wheels physically scrape off rust from the surface.

    • Advantages: Safe for precision parts if carefully controlled, no chemical residues.

    • Limitations: Time-consuming for large batches or heavy rust.

             Wire brushing :

External wire brushing                                                                                                                                             Inner hole brushing

 

When our tube fittings develop rust, the outside surface can be cleaned using wire brushing; however, this is a time-consuming and costly method. Unless no alternative is available, we do not recommend this approach.

For rust inside the inner holes, wire brushing (see second photo) or mounting a handheld grinding wheel can be used effectively. For lightly rusted surfaces, or inner holes with a diameter below 30 mm, wire brushing can be used for quick removal. When using a handheld grinding wheel, the tool should be fixed in a stationary position, and the product aligned with the wheel to remove rust efficiently.”

    Scouring pad-suitable flat suraface

A scouring pad can be mounted on a handheld grinding wheel. This setup is suitable for polishing flat surfaces of tube fitting and removing light rust. Simply hold the workpiece steadily and move it gently against the spinning pad. It is a quick and safe way to clean surfaces without causing scratches.

 

Wire wheels

Wire wheels are commonly used for rust removal on metal parts surfaces. By mounting a wire wheel on a handheld grinder or bench grinder, operators can efficiently clean both flat surfaces and inner holes with moderate rust. For optimal results, the workpiece should be held steadily, and the wire wheel applied with consistent pressure to avoid surface damage. Wire wheels are particularly effective for removing heavy rust and scale, but may not be suitable for very delicate surfaces.    

Sandpaper

Simply using sandpaper by hand to remove rust is considered an outdated method. When our cnc parts develop rust, we usually mount them on a CNC lathe, reduce the spindle speed, and then use sandpaper for rust removal. This method allows efficient cleaning of both inner holes and outer cylindrical surfaces, improving consistency and saving time compared to manual sanding.

  1. Chemical (Solution-Based) Rust Removal for pipe fitting

    • Chemical rust removal can involve neutral rust removers, chemical solutions, pickling (acid treatment), or water-based polishing processes to clean the metal surfaces.

    • Advantages: Faster and effective on heavy rust.

    • Limitations: Needs thorough rinsing and drying; strong acids can damage metal or change dimensions if not controlled.

Proper selection between physical and chemical methods depends on part precision, rust severity, and surface finish requirements.

             Based on my real experience ,  i do not suggest chemical rust removal .

    Neutral rust removers

In this case, I can share detailed photos from our real tests, showing rust formation on the hexagonal section of our blanks.

We normally use a chemical rust remover by mixing 1 kg of the solution with 9 kg of water. The workpieces are then soaked in this mixture for about 10 minutes until the rust is removed. However, using this method, we sometimes observe the formation of red rust and surface marks after treatment.

Chemical solutions

When chemical rust removers are used, the surface of the products often loses its original shine and becomes dull. Although the rust is removed, the treatment can affect the aesthetic appearance, making the metal look less bright and smooth.

Acid treatment Practical Experience:

  • Acid treatment Pickling, or acid treatment, is a chemical method used to remove rust and scale from metal surfaces. The workpiece is immersed in an acidic solution, which dissolves the rust and cleans the surface. While this method is effective and fast, it requires careful control of acid concentration and treatment time to avoid damaging the metal or altering its dimensions. After acid treatment, thorough rinsing and drying are essential to prevent re-rusting

  • We tried this way 2 times , but this method will also let surface darkness . And it will get rust 15-30 minutes . So must put in oil fast after acid treatment .

Conclusion

Surface rust on steel tube fitting is common problem, especially for products requiring a natural, anti-rust oil finish without plating. Physical rust removal—such as wire brushing, scouring pads, wire wheels, or sandpaper on a CNC lathe parts—is safe, controllable, and preserves the surface finish. Chemical methods, including neutral rust removers, acid pickling, or water-based polishing, can be faster for heavy rust but may darken the surface, reduce shine, or cause red rust if not carefully controlled.

Based on our experience, we recommend physical rust removal for precision and aesthetic quality, with prompt application of anti-rust oil after any chemical treatment.
